Deadline Extended for 2 GHz Broadband Public Notice Responses
6/16/2011
The FCC
extended the deadline for comments
in the Public Notice
Spectrum Task Force Invites Technical Input on Approaches to Maximize Broadband Use of Fixed/Mobile Spectrum Allocations in the 2GHz Range
.
The deadline for comments is now set for July 18, 2011, with replies due by Aug. 1, 2011. The extension was requested by CTIA and Sprint-Nextel.
In the request Sprint stated the proceeding "raises several novel, far-reaching proposals and concepts . . . including particularly intricate technical and interference issues," and said that an additional 30 days would "facilitate the development of a full and informed record."
The FCC Spectrum Task Force suggested allowing stand-alone terrestrial services in the mobile satellite service (MSS) 2 GHz bands (some adjacent to 2 GHz BAS operations), and possible pairing of AWS bands. The Public Notice also requested comment on what to do with MSS incumbents. See
